A man in Spalding County, Georgia, was fatally shot after confronting three individuals who were egging his house. The incident occurred on July 3 when deputies received a call about a man down in the roadway. Upon arrival, they discovered the man with a gunshot wound, and he was later identified as Johnathan Gilbert, also known as Tyler Lane.

According to Sheriff Darrell Dix, three people identified as Sydney Maughon, Jeremy Munson, and McKenzie Davenport went to Gilbert’s residence to vandalize it by egging it. When Gilbert noticed their actions, he came out unarmed to confront them. As the three suspects drove away, Maughon allegedly pulled out a gun and shot Gilbert multiple times.

The suspects were later tracked down by their cellphone numbers to an address in Henry County. Henry County officers found the car and gun believed to be connected with Gilbert’s death. Maughon has been charged with murder, malice murder, aggravated assault, possession of a firearm during the commission of a crime, battery-family violence, and criminal trespass. Munson was charged with murder, malice murder, aggravated assault, possession of a firearm during the commission of a crime, battery, and criminal trespass, while Davenport was charged with malice murder, battery, and criminal trespass.

The police stated that because the three suspects planned and traveled together with the intent to commit a crime that led to Gilbert’s murder, they are all equally responsible. They emphasized that even though they went to egg the house, the victim’s confrontation resulted in his tragic death, and the suspects callously left his body in the middle of the road.
